Transaction 73ecbc7ef93bdda8df12a5037dcc33600409039186c0262c8e3b158078e59cef
1 Input
2 Outputs
- 73ecbc7ef93bdda8df12a5037dcc33600409039186c0262c8e3b158078e59cef:0
- 73ecbc7ef93bdda8df12a5037dcc33600409039186c0262c8e3b158078e59cef:1
value 23746
address 1hVthFuZS5qPoaex3UmErBpRrwAermLdS
value 170000
address 367SrdCZ4BX2AzRahv3cKFGpKfAk6kHf5f